Receiving an item you didn’t order can be a confusing experience. Many people report getting unexpected packages, which raises questions about errors in online shopping or delivery miscommunications. Understanding how to interact with customer service can help you resolve these issues promptly. When you find yourself in this situation, first, check your order history to verify whether the mistake was on your end. If it wasn’t, contact the seller immediately to explain the situation. Most reputable companies will either send you the correct item or provide information on how to return the incorrect one. Be polite but firm to get the best results.
